Christians praying for Archbishop of York

Christians have been wishing the Archbishop of York, Dr John Sentamu, all the best as he recovers from surgery to treat advanced prostate cancer PA

Christians are rallying around the Archbishop of York after he revealed today that he has been treated on for advanced prostate cancer.

Dr John Sentamu said he would be "out of action for some time" following the operation today at St James' Hospital.

"I will continue to value your prayers," he said.

Christians and other friends and supporters responded within minutes of the news breaking by taking to Twitter to wish the Archbishop the best and ask other Christians to join them in praying for him:
